    US: TRANSFORMER MARKET, BY END USER, 2025–2030

    Segment202520262027202820292030CAGR (%)
    DATA CENTERS1234.91316.21409.71518.21646.11798.77.8
    INDUSTRIAL2463.22608.727752966.93191.13456.87
    OTHER END USERS872.2922.297910441119.31207.76.7
    POWER UTILITIES7827.48243.88716.89259.39889.310630.36.3
    RESIDENTIAL & COMMERCIAL1364.11449.31546.916601792.61950.37.4
    TOTAL13761.814540.215427.416448.417638.319043.86.7

    Market Definition

    The global transformer market serves as a critical backbone of the power infrastructure, enabling efficient and safe transmission and distribution of electricity across various voltage levels. Transformers are essential for adjusting voltage levels—either stepping them up or down—to enable the efficient transmission of electricity from power generation sources, both conventional and renewable, over long distances with minimal losses. They are critical components not only for utility networks but also for industrial facilities, data centers, transportation infrastructure, and residential and commercial buildings. As global trends shift toward electrification, smart grid modernization, and integrating decentralized energy sources, the demand for advanced, reliable, and energy-efficient transformers has grown significantly.

    The market encompasses various products, including power, distribution, instrument, and specialty transformers designed for specific applications such as marine, railways, and metros. Moreover, the evolution of transformer technology is increasingly influenced by digitalization trends, environmental regulations, and the growing focus on sustainability. Manufacturers are developing eco-friendly, low-loss, smart transformers to meet stringent energy efficiency mandates and grid reliability requirements. As global power demand rises and infrastructure ages, the transformer market is positioned for long-term growth, supported by grid expansion, renewable energy projects, and urban infrastructure developments across emerging and developed economies.
